Heterocycles X V- one pot synthesis of indenyl pyrimidine- 2 - ones

Description

Condensation of 1- indanone, aryl aldehydes (Ia-k) and urea revealed the formation of the corresponding dihydropyrimidinones (I Ia - k). these were acetaldeyde and brominated to give compounds (III) and (IV) respective l. Dehydrogenation of (II) gave the corresponding pyrimuidunones (V). The structures of the products (II - V) were substantiated by chemical and spectral methods. In a previous work, 1- indanone was reacted with guanidine to produce 2- amino - isopropylenediamine (1) . On the other hand, indenyl pyrimidine - 2- ones were previously prepared through a multi - step synthesis (2,3). The present investigation describes a one - pot synthesis of some new dihydropyrimidinones (I Ia - K). Thus 1- indanone and urea were condensed with aryl aldehydes (Ia - K) to produce the corresponding 4- aryl - 3,4- dihydro - 5 [H] - indenyl (1,2 -e) py rimidin - 2 (I H) ones (I Ia - K) (2,3). The structure of these products was substantiated by chemical and spectral methods as well as elemental analysis.(author). 11 refs., 3 table
